Rhonda Huntress Posted May 7, 2019 Share Posted May 7, 2019 Yep, good ol' transparency stack glitch. Tattoos, makeup, stockings, appliers of any kind, clothes and hair will all cause this if more than one texture has an alpha layer. Not much we can do about it but limit the amount of alpha (transparent) layers we have on.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Skell Dagger Posted May 7, 2019 Share Posted May 7, 2019 If the glitching tops are applier ones (and the alphas aren't something like delicate lace) then try setting the applier layer to 'mask' instead of 'blend'. However, if it's transparent mesh clothing causing the issue then try editing your hair (if it can be edited) and changing the alpha masking on the offending sections, as per this video. (As with the appliers, though, this only works well on 'sleek' textures; any hair sections that are feathered or curly won't look good when masked). Your final option is to try the materials version of your hair, if it comes with that as an option. What you're encountering is the OpenGL alpha glitch, which is an annoyance we can only (currently) mitigate with judicious use of masking and blending on mesh body parts.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
